The utility model discloses a frameless panel lamp, which comprises a plurality of frame strips, a diffuser plate, a light guide plate, a reflective plate and a light source assembly. A closed area is surrounded by a plurality of frame strips, each frame strip includes a frame strip main body, a set A resisting portion extending toward the closed area at one end of the main body of the frame bar, and a convex portion provided at the other end of the main body of the frame bar and extending toward the closed area, each side of the diffusion plate is provided with a corresponding convex portion on each frame bar Matching recesses, the recesses on each side extend along the entire length of the side, the diffuser is installed on multiple frame bars through the cooperation of the protrusions and recesses, and the light guide plate and reflector are sandwiched between the diffuser and the multiple Between the resisting parts of the frame bars. According to the utility model, the diffuser plate of the utility model is installed on a plurality of frame bars through the cooperation of the convex part and the concave part. Compared with the prior art, drilling threaded holes and screwing are omitted, so that the assembly can be carried out quickly and conveniently, and the panel can be improved. lamp production efficiency.

背景技术Background technique

无边框面板灯由包括由若干框条组成的边框、安装于边框内侧壁上的电路板、安装于电路板一侧的若干LED以及搭装于框架内的导光板、扩散板、反光板组成。LED光源组件发出的光由导光板的侧面进入导光板内、再经扩散板发散出去。The frameless panel light consists of a frame composed of several frame strips, a circuit board installed on the inner wall of the frame, a number of LEDs installed on one side of the circuit board, and a light guide plate, a diffuser plate, and a reflector plate mounted in the frame. The light emitted by the LED light source assembly enters the light guide plate from the side of the light guide plate, and then is emitted through the diffuser plate.

目前在组装面板灯时,通常需要在反光板、导光板和扩散板上钻螺纹孔,然后螺丝依次穿设在框条、反光板、导光板和扩散板中而将反光板、导光板和扩散板固定在边框内,螺丝是自攻固定在扩散板里面,但是这种组装方式会存在一下缺点:一是,由于需要钻螺纹孔和打螺丝,使得面板灯组装过程繁琐、复杂,生产效率低;二是,会出现螺丝断在扩散板里面的情况,导致扩散板报废率很高;三是,面板灯点亮后,螺丝的位置会出现黑点、黑印,影响发光均匀性。At present, when assembling panel lights, it is usually necessary to drill threaded holes on the reflector, light guide plate and diffuser plate, and then screw through the frame strip, reflector plate, light guide plate and diffuser plate in order to connect the reflector plate, light guide plate and diffuser plate. The plate is fixed in the frame, and the screws are self-tapping and fixed in the diffusion plate, but this assembly method has some disadvantages: First, due to the need to drill threaded holes and screw, the assembly process of the panel light is cumbersome and complicated, and the production efficiency is low Second, there will be situations where the screws are broken inside the diffusion plate, resulting in a high scrap rate of the diffusion plate; third, after the panel light is turned on, black spots and black marks will appear at the position of the screws, which will affect the uniformity of light emission.

具体实施方式Detailed ways

如图1,本实用新型实施例中提出的无边框面板灯,包括多个框条10、扩散板20、导光板30、反光板40和光源组件,多个框条10围成一闭合区域,多个框条采用铝合金制成。本实施例中具有四个框条10,该四个框条10首尾依次连接构成矩形边框,而且该四个边框围成一闭矩形合区域,扩散板20、导光板30、反光板40都为矩形,反光板40采用铝背板。As shown in Figure 1, the frameless panel light proposed in the embodiment of the utility model includes a plurality of frame bars 10, a diffuser plate 20, a light guide plate 30, a reflector plate 40 and a light source assembly, and a plurality of frame bars 10 enclose a closed area, Multiple frame bars are made of aluminum alloy. In this embodiment, there are four frame strips 10, the four frame strips 10 are connected end to end to form a rectangular frame, and the four frames surround a closed rectangular closed area, and the diffuser plate 20, the light guide plate 30, and the reflective plate 40 are all Rectangular, the reflector 40 adopts an aluminum backboard.

如图2和图3,每个框条10包括框条主体11、设置于框条主体11一端(本实施例中为上端)的朝向闭合区域延伸的抵挡部12,以及设于框条主体11另一端(本实施例中为下端)的朝向闭合区域延伸的凸部111。框条主体11为一条形板,凸部111可以具有多个并在框条主体11的整个长度上呈一字间隔分布,凸部111也可以只有一个并分布在框条主体11的整个长度上。扩散板20的每个侧面上对应设置有与每个框条上的凸部111相适配的凹部21(即本实施例中扩散板的四个侧面上分别设置有与四个框条上的凸部相适配的凹部,一个侧面上的凹部与一个框条上的凸部相适配),每个侧面上的凹部21沿该侧面的整个长度延伸。扩散板20的每个面上均设置有L形缺口,每个面上的L形缺口沿该面的整个长度延伸,在L形缺口的竖直面上设置有凹部,框条主体另一端(本实施例中为下端)的凸部与凹部配合后,L形缺口的竖直面挡住框条主体,即从面板灯的发光面向后看时,看不到框条,框条隐藏在了扩散板后面,从而形成无边框面板灯。As shown in Figures 2 and 3, each frame bar 10 includes a frame bar body 11, a resisting portion 12 disposed at one end (in this embodiment, the upper end) of the frame bar body 11 extending toward the closed area, and a frame bar body 11 The other end (the lower end in this embodiment) is a convex portion 111 extending toward the closed area. The frame body 11 is a strip-shaped plate. There may be multiple convex parts 111 and they are distributed at intervals along the entire length of the frame body 11. There may also be only one convex part 111 and they are distributed over the entire length of the frame body 11. . Each side of the diffuser plate 20 is correspondingly provided with a concave portion 21 that matches the convex portion 111 on each frame bar (that is, the four sides of the diffuser plate in this embodiment are respectively provided with Concaves 21 on each side extend along the entire length of the side. Each surface of the diffuser plate 20 is provided with an L-shaped notch, and the L-shaped notch on each surface extends along the entire length of the surface, and a recess is provided on the vertical surface of the L-shaped notch, and the other end of the main body of the frame bar ( In this embodiment, after the convex part of the lower end) is matched with the concave part, the vertical surface of the L-shaped notch blocks the frame body. behind the panel, thus forming a frameless panel light.

如图2,扩散板20通过凸部111与凹部21相配合而安装到多个框条10上,且导光板30和反光板40夹在扩散板20与多个框条的抵挡部12之间。这样在组装面板灯时,先将反光板和导光板依次放置在三个框条的抵挡部上,然后再将扩散板通过凸部和凹部的配合推拉安装到三个框条上,最后安装第四个框条即可,从而快速、方便的进行组装,提高了面板灯生产效率。As shown in Figure 2, the diffusion plate 20 is mounted on a plurality of frame bars 10 through the cooperation of the convex portion 111 and the concave portion 21, and the light guide plate 30 and the light reflection plate 40 are sandwiched between the diffuser plate 20 and the resisting portions 12 of the plurality of frame bars . In this way, when assembling the panel light, first place the reflector and the light guide plate on the resisting parts of the three frame bars in sequence, then install the diffuser plate on the three frame bars through the cooperation of the convex part and the concave part, and finally install the third frame bar. Four frame strips are enough, so that the assembly can be carried out quickly and conveniently, and the production efficiency of the panel light is improved.

如图2和图3,框条主体11上位于抵挡部12与凸部111之间设置有向闭合区域延伸的定位块112,定位块112、框条主体11和凸部111之间形成凹槽113,光源组件固定在凹槽113内。光源组件包括PCB板51和固定在PCB板51上的灯珠52,PCB板51固定在凹槽113朝向闭合区域的槽壁(本实施例中为底壁)上。As shown in Fig. 2 and Fig. 3, a positioning block 112 extending toward the closed area is provided on the main body 11 of the frame strip between the resisting portion 12 and the convex portion 111, and a groove is formed between the positioning block 112, the main body 11 of the frame strip and the convex portion 111 113 , the light source assembly is fixed in the groove 113 . The light source assembly includes a PCB board 51 and a lamp bead 52 fixed on the PCB board 51 , and the PCB board 51 is fixed on the groove wall (the bottom wall in this embodiment) facing the closed area of the groove 113 .

如图2和图3,抵挡部12上具有凸台121,凸台121向扩散板20延伸,凸台121与框条主体11之间具有间距,凸台121朝向扩散板20的面上设置有夹紧块122,四个框条上的夹紧块122夹住反光板40的侧面。As shown in Figures 2 and 3, there is a boss 121 on the resisting portion 12, and the boss 121 extends toward the diffuser plate 20. Clamping block 122 , the clamping block 122 on the four frame bars clamps the side of the reflector 40 .

如图1,相邻两个框条10之间通过拐角连接块60进行连接。如图2,凸台12上设置有用来安装拐角连接块的通孔123。拐角连接块为直角结构,拐角连接块的两个连接臂分别伸入相邻两个框条上的通孔内,并通过螺丝与两个框条连接。本实施例中通孔数量为两个,该两个通孔上下设置,这样相邻两个框条之间通过两个拐角连接板进行连接。As shown in FIG. 1 , two adjacent frame strips 10 are connected by corner connecting blocks 60 . As shown in FIG. 2 , the boss 12 is provided with a through hole 123 for installing a corner connecting block. The corner connecting block has a right-angle structure, and the two connecting arms of the corner connecting block respectively extend into through holes on two adjacent frame bars, and are connected with the two frame bars by screws. In this embodiment, the number of through holes is two, and the two through holes are set up and down, so that two adjacent frame bars are connected through two corner connecting plates.

如图1和图4,该无边框面板灯还包括多个安装座70,安装座70用于将无边框面板灯安装在天花板上,每个安装座70包括第一连接板71和与第一连接板71垂直设置的第二连接板72,第一连接板71置于框条上的通孔内并通过螺丝与框条固定连接。本实施例中共有八个安装座,每个框条上安装两个安装座。As shown in Figures 1 and 4, the frameless panel light also includes a plurality of mounting seats 70, the mounting seats 70 are used to install the frameless panel light on the ceiling, and each mounting seat 70 includes a first connecting plate 71 and a first The connecting plate 71 is vertically arranged with the second connecting plate 72, and the first connecting plate 71 is placed in the through hole on the frame bar and fixedly connected with the frame bar by screws. There are eight mounting seats in this embodiment, and two mounting seats are installed on each frame bar.

如图1,该无边框面板灯还包括一固定板81和两个固定块82,固定板71的两端分别与两个固定块82固定连接,优选为螺钉连接。两个固定块82分别固定在相对设置的两个框条10上,从而紧固面板灯,优选为螺钉连接。As shown in FIG. 1 , the frameless panel light also includes a fixing plate 81 and two fixing blocks 82 , and the two ends of the fixing plate 71 are respectively fixedly connected with the two fixing blocks 82 , preferably by screws. The two fixing blocks 82 are respectively fixed on the two opposite frame bars 10 so as to fasten the panel light, preferably by screw connection.
